Tree crown shaping services involve the careful pruning and trimming of a tree’s upper branches to improve its overall structure and appearance. This process typically targets the removal of dead, damaged, or overgrown limbs, helping to create a balanced and aesthetically pleasing canopy. Tree specialists use precise techniques to ensure that the natural growth pattern of the tree is maintained while addressing any structural concerns. The goal is to enhance the tree’s visual appeal and promote healthy development over time.
One of the primary benefits of tree crown shaping is the mitigation of potential hazards caused by overgrown or unstable branches. Unpruned or poorly maintained crowns can pose risks to people, property, and the tree itself, especially during storms or high winds. Crown shaping can reduce the likelihood of branch breakage and falling debris, thereby improving safety around residential, commercial, or public properties. Additionally, this service can help prevent issues such as branch encroachment on buildings, power lines, or walkways, ensuring clear and safe surroundings.

Basic Crown Shaping - Typically costs between $200 and $500 for small to medium trees. This service involves minimal trimming to improve shape and health. Costs vary based on tree size and complexity.
Moderate Crown Reshaping - Usually ranges from $500 to $1,200 for larger trees or more extensive pruning. It includes detailed shaping to enhance appearance and safety. Prices depend on tree height and branch density.
Advanced Crown Sculpting - Can cost $1,200 to $3,000 or more for complex or mature trees. This service involves precise work to achieve specific aesthetic goals or structural improvements. Costs are influenced by tree size and the extent of shaping needed.
Custom Crown Design - Typically starts around $1,000 and can go up depending on the scope. This involves tailored shaping to meet specific landscape or design preferences. Pricing varies based on project complexity and tree accessibility.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is tree crown shaping? Tree crown shaping involves pruning and trimming to improve the appearance and health of a tree's canopy.
Why should I consider tree crown shaping? Proper crown shaping can enhance the tree's aesthetic appeal, promote healthy growth, and reduce potential hazards from overgrown branches.
How is tree crown shaping performed? Local tree service providers typically assess the tree and then prune or trim branches to achieve the desired shape and health.
Is tree crown shaping suitable for all types of trees? Most deciduous and some evergreen trees can benefit from crown shaping, but suitability depends on the specific species and condition.
How often should tree crown shaping be done? The frequency varies based on the tree's growth rate and type, but regular inspections can help determine appropriate timing.
